PENERAPAN MODEL PEMBELAJARAN PROBLEM BASED LEARNING UNTUK MENINGKATKAN PEMAHAMAN KONSEP PERKALIAN DAN HASIL BELAJAR SISWA KELAS IV SD NEGERI 1 LAWANG

Keywords: problem based learning, multiplication concept, learning outcomes

Abstract

Learning needs to be done by encourging students and creating fun learning so that students
can experience the learning process as an experience. This is also applied to learning mathematics with
the topic of multiplication, where students don’t fully understand the concept of multiplication as
repeated addition. This research aims to describe implementation of Problem Based Learning model to
improve understanding of the multiplication concept and learning outcomes of 4th grade students at
Lawang 1 State Elementary School. The research subjects is 4th grade students at Lawang 1 State
Elementary School. This research uses Classroom Action Research conducted in two cycles. The results
of the research showed an increase in understanding of the concept of multiplication from cycle I to
cycle II as seen from the process of solving multiplication problems. The learning outcomes of 4th grade
students which was seen from students classical learning completeness in the first cycle is 43,75%
increasing to 71% in the second cycle. The average grade increased from 61,25 to 77,5. So, it can be
concluded that the application of the Problem Based learning model can increase understanding
concept of multiplication and learning outcomes of 4th grade students at Lawang 1 State Elementary
School.
